Lionel Messi 'will not go on loan after the MLS season'

Lionel Messi will reportedly not leave Inter Miami at the end of the MLS season despite interest in a loan deal from Barcelona and the Saudi Pro League.
Sports Mole

Lionel Messi will reportedly not join any other team on loan when the current Major League Soccer season ends.

The Inter Miami captain has been linked with a possible return to former employers Barcelona as well as a potential switch to the Saudi Pro League.

The Herons are currently second-bottom in the Eastern Conference and missed out on an MLS playoff spot following their 1-0 loss to FC Cincinnati last weekend.

However, Spanish football expert Guillem Balague claims that Messi is not considering a temporary switch to another club and will instead enjoy his time off by going on a month-long holiday.

The reporter adds that the Argentine will return to Miami following his holiday and resume pre-season preparation before the league recommences next February.

The seven-time Ballon d'Or winner transferred from Paris Saint-Germain to Inter Miami in July, and guided the club to their first-ever Leagues Cup triumph in August but subsequently experienced a loss in the US Open Cup.

The current Inter Miami and former Barcelona manager Tata Martino asserted that he is not aware of any such rumours.

"That's surprising. I know nothing about that. If you're telling me that he's going to go visit Barcelona on vacation, yes, it's probable, but I don't have any information on the other part." Martino said after Saturday's loss.

Despite scoring 11 goals in 13 games for the team, Messi has only managed to score one goal in his five appearances in the MLS.
